Security personnel in course of the operations launched in Rukum rescued Purna Bahadur Shahi, a British Embassy employee who had been abducted by the Maoists two months back, security sources said.

As the Maoists were fleeing the areas in Rukum after the launching of a massive security operation, Shahi came forward and gave his identity calling on the security personnel to rescue him.

Shahi works for the British Welfare Scheme. His abduction had stirred a lot of anxiety in the west as it was the first incident of abduction of an employee working for a foreign mission in Nepal.
